Socceroos keeper Mat Ryan makes Arsenal debut in English Premier League defeat to Aston Villa

Socceroos goalkeeper Mat Ryan has made his debut for Arsenal, the English Premier League club he supported as a kid, producing a number of classy saves, albeit in a 1-0 loss to Aston Villa.
It was a baptism of fire for Ryan as after just 74 seconds he was beaten by a deflected shot from Villa’s Ollie Watkins, the only goal of the match at Villa Park.
The goal came after a loose pass by Arsenal’s Cedric Soares, with Watkins’ strike deflecting off Rob Holding to squirm past Ryan.
But Ryan went on to make seven saves in a strong debut, including a diving stop to deny Jack Grealish late in the game.
He also saved from Villa’s Ross Barkley, John McGinn and Watkins in the second half.
